摘要
This paper examines the implications of renewable energy (RE) deployment in power generation for residential consumption in the Middle East and North Africa (MENA) region under various RE penetration targets. A comparative assessment revealed a great heterogeneity among countries with Turkey dominating as the highest emitter. At the sub-regional level, the Middle East sub-region contributes more than double the GHG emissions estimated for the Gulf and North Africa sub-regions with all sub-regions achieving reductions in the range of 6-38% depending on the RE target penetration and promising up to 54% savings on investment excluding positive externalities associated with the offset of greenhouse gas (GHG) emissions savings.
